    Why the Garage Door Matters More Than You Think

    In most homes, the garage door takes up anywhere from 30% to 40% of the front facade. That makes it one of the most visually dominant features of your home's exterior. A faded, dented, or dated garage door can drag down the entire curb appeal of an otherwise beautiful home — while a fresh, stylish door can instantly modernize it.

    Colorado's Climate Makes Replacement Even More Valuable

    Colorado's extreme weather takes a toll on garage doors faster than many homeowners realize. The intense UV exposure at altitude fades paint and warps wood panels. Freeze-thaw cycles crack weather stripping and cause steel panels to contract and expand repeatedly. Heavy spring snow loads stress aging hinges and tracks.

    A new insulated steel or composite door doesn't just look better — it performs better under these conditions. Improved insulation (measured in R-value) keeps your garage warmer in winter, reducing energy loss through the attached garage into your home.

    Style Options That Complement Your Home

    Today's garage doors come in a remarkable range of styles, materials, and finishes:

    • Carriage house doors — Perfect for craftsman-style and traditional Colorado homes
    • Contemporary flush panels — Clean lines for modern builds
    • Wood-look steel — The warmth of wood without the maintenance headaches
    • Full-view aluminum — Modern, open aesthetic with glass panels
    • Custom colors and hardware — Match your home's trim and accent colors precisely

    What's the Real ROI?

    A mid-range garage door replacement in the Denver Metro typically costs between $1,000 and $3,500 installed, depending on size, material, and insulation rating. At resale, buyers in Colorado's competitive housing market consistently pay more for homes with updated garage doors — often $4,000 to $6,000 more than comparable homes with older doors. That's a net gain before you even count the energy savings and reduced maintenance costs.
